Pytorinox | Raspberry Pi helpers written in Python3

audio_alsa.py - play back wav sounds via alsa lib. audio_simple.py - play back wav sounds via simpleaudio lib. audio_aplay.py - play back wave sound via external tool (aplay). bme280.py - read temperature, humidity and pressure from bme280 sensor (i2c). buzzer.py - play simple melodies via pwm. fbi.py - frame buffer image viewer tool (simple demo of framebuffer.py). framebuffer.py - render an Image into a linux framebuffer device. l3g4200d.py - 3 axis gyroscope (i2c). midi.py - extract simple melodies from midi files for use with buzzer.py. menu.py - scrollable menus rendered into an Image. morph.py - dali clock style text morphing. rotary_encoder.py - decoder for rotary encoder switches. spi_display.py - render an image on an SPI display (supports several OLED, TFT and E-Ink drivers). ttp229.py - capacitive touch sensor (i2c). tts.py - text-to-speech via external tools (pico2wave, aplay).
